Well, the frags I bought from Kevin (ReefRunner) made it in today. They are in the process of being acclimated. Here are some quick shots that I took. You will have to forgive the quality of the pictures as I was more interested in making sure the coral was doing ok rather than getting a good picture...

Since they were all shipped in separate bags (all 14 of them) I decided it would be easier to float all the bags in the tank for around 30 minutes and then put all the coral into one bucket and acclimate them all at the same time. I figured since they were all bagged up at the same time with the same water it wouldn't matter if I mixed them all to acclimate.
